Asbestos Attorneys

Despite the fact that asbestos use declined in the 1970s exposure to this dangerous mineral may cause life-threatening illnesses like mesothelioma. New York residents should contact a mesothelioma attorney if they suspect they or their family members have been exposed to asbestos.

Asbestos lawyers may sue the owners of worksites or buildings and asbestos product manufacturers and other responsible parties. Some lawyers specialize in filing claims for veterans' compensation and trust funds compensation.

Workers' Compensation

Injured workers who are sickened by asbestos exposure might be eligible to claim workers compensation benefits. Benefits from workers' compensation can include medical costs, partial wages, and other costs that are incurred due to workplace injuries. However, workers' comp claims may not be the best option for those who are exposed to asbestos since they have a short time period within which to file and also offer lower maximum benefits than mesothelioma or personal injury lawsuits.

An experienced attorney can determine whether an asbestos-related illness is a work injury and if the person is eligible for workers' compensation. An attorney can also explain state-specific workers' compensation laws and assist in meeting the deadlines for filing claims, which vary by state. An attorney can also offer advice on other legal options for obtaining compensation, such as filing mesothelioma lawsuits or asbestos trust fund claim.

A lawyer can identify the most likely sources of liability in the event of an asbestos-related illness. Asbestos is a fibrous substance that can lead to serious health issues, such as asbestosis and mesothelioma. An attorney can investigate the background of the client's employer and locate potential asbestos-exposure locations. The most likely employers for people suffering from an asbestos-related illness are construction and demolition companies, shipyards, power plants and schools as well as other public works facilities.

Asbestos fibers can become airborne, and employees and people visiting a construction site could inhale asbestos fibers. The microscopic fibers of asbestos can get lodged in lungs and other organs of the body creating inflammation and scarring which can lead to tumors, cancers and other diseases. Asbestos victims may not realize that their health issues are related to their exposure until years after the fact.

A New York workers' compensation lawyer can help get people the financial assistance they require while also seeking justice against negligent employers. This is particularly important for those suffering from asbestos-related diseases like mesothelioma. Asbestos patients often must quit their jobs due to their health issues and might also face additional costs like funeral costs or caregiving for family members. An experienced attorney can help them seek full and fair compensation.

Personal Injury

Asbestos lawyers help victims who have been exposed to asbestos and are suffering from an illness or illness like mesothelioma. The condition is diagnosed 15 to 60 years after exposure and can be fatal. In addition to bringing a lawsuit against the company that caused exposure, victims may also be eligible to receive financial compensation from asbestos victim trust funds.

Asbestos is made up of fine, tough fibres. Because of its resistance to fire, heat and chemicals the mineral was sought-after by industrial manufacturers for a variety of items in the 20th century. Unfortunately, the manufacturing companies failed to disclose or actively conceal asbestos' dangers and led to the deaths of thousands of Americans.

Patients suffering from asbestos-related diseases such as mesothelioma or lung cancer, can sue the companies that produced the material, distributed it, or even installed the deadly material. The lawsuits seek compensation for medical bills, lost wages and pain and suffering.

In general, New York law gives plaintiffs three years from the date of their diagnosis to file a personal injury lawsuit. However this time frame is usually extended in asbestos cases as symptoms are not typically evident for 30 to 50 years following the initial exposure.

Experienced mesothelioma lawyers can assist victims and their families in determining the exact source of exposure. They can help victims by using the nationwide resources of asbestos firms to determine the time and place the location of exposure.

The attorneys can then make an appeal for workers' compensation on behalf of the victims or, if the employer ceases to be operating or has gone out of business, make a claim against the asbestos manufacturer. The lawyers can also assist clients to receive VA benefits or financial compensation from asbestos trust fund even if they aren't eligible for' compensation.

Many people suffering from asbestos-related diseases are disabled and require costly medical treatments. An experienced mesothelioma lawyer will fight for financial compensation to cover the medical costs of patients and allow them to live a normal life as they recover.

Wrongful Death

If a person dies a result of asbestos exposure and their family members can be able to file a wrongful-death claim. This type of lawsuit is filed on behalf of the decedent's estate, and can be filed regardless of whether or not the decedent had a will. A wrongful death attorney could help family members seek compensation from the people responsible for their loved one's death.

These claims are filed against employers and property owners who failed to protect their employees from asbestos. In these cases, the primary problem is that asbestos particles inhaled cause fibrosis to the lining of the lung. Over time the fibrosis turns malignant and may develop into tumors, such as mesothelioma. Asbestos wrongful-death lawyers must prove that the defendant's wrongful conduct caused the asbestos-related disease. They must also prove that mesothelioma was the direct result of the asbestos exposure. This involves obtaining medical records, speaking with witnesses, and obtaining documents from workplaces where the decedent was employed.

Wrongful death attorneys for asbestos exposure will ensure that their clients receive the maximum amount of compensation they deserve. Compensation can cover a range of losses, such as lost wages and medical expenses. Additionally mesothelioma compensation will be used to pay for funeral expenses and loss of companionship.
